[Tips] [Windows Phone 7 (Beat)] 如何讓硬體的返回鍵不作用
2010-09-01 15:22
351 查看
Windows Phone 7上硬體有一個返回按鍵,某些時候我們需要讓它不起作用。
這時候可以先註冊BackKeyPress ,再把它的Cancel設為true就行了。
public Mianpage()
{
InitializeComponent();
this.BackKeyPress += new EventHandler<System.ComponentModel.CancelEventArgs>(PhonePage1_BackKeyPress);
}
void PhonePage1_BackKeyPress(object sender, System.ComponentModel.CancelEventArgs e)
{
e.Cancel = true;
}
Copyright © 2010 B+ Studio.
.csharpcode, .csharpcode pre
{
font-size: small;
color: black;
font-family: consolas, "Courier New", courier, monospace;
background-color: #ffffff;
/*white-space: pre;*/
}
.csharpcode pre { margin: 0em; }
.csharpcode .rem { color: #008000; }
.csharpcode .kwrd { color: #0000ff; }
.csharpcode .str { color: #006080; }
.csharpcode .op { color: #0000c0; }
.csharpcode .preproc { color: #cc6633; }
.csharpcode .asp { background-color: #ffff00; }
.csharpcode .html { color: #800000; }
.csharpcode .attr { color: #ff0000; }
.csharpcode .alt
{
background-color: #f4f4f4;
width: 100%;
margin: 0em;
}
.csharpcode .lnum { color: #606060; }
這時候可以先註冊BackKeyPress ,再把它的Cancel設為true就行了。
public Mianpage()
{
InitializeComponent();
this.BackKeyPress += new EventHandler<System.ComponentModel.CancelEventArgs>(PhonePage1_BackKeyPress);
}
void PhonePage1_BackKeyPress(object sender, System.ComponentModel.CancelEventArgs e)
{
e.Cancel = true;
}
Copyright © 2010 B+ Studio.
.csharpcode, .csharpcode pre
{
font-size: small;
color: black;
font-family: consolas, "Courier New", courier, monospace;
background-color: #ffffff;
/*white-space: pre;*/
}
.csharpcode pre { margin: 0em; }
.csharpcode .rem { color: #008000; }
.csharpcode .kwrd { color: #0000ff; }
.csharpcode .str { color: #006080; }
.csharpcode .op { color: #0000c0; }
.csharpcode .preproc { color: #cc6633; }
.csharpcode .asp { background-color: #ffff00; }
.csharpcode .html { color: #800000; }
.csharpcode .attr { color: #ff0000; }
.csharpcode .alt
{
background-color: #f4f4f4;
width: 100%;
margin: 0em;
}
.csharpcode .lnum { color: #606060; }
相关文章推荐
- [Tips] [Windows Phone 7 (Beta)] 如何設定應用程式起始頁(RootFrame)
- [Tips] [Windows Phone 7] 如何開啟和關閉畫面更新率(Frame Rate Counters)的顯示
- Windows Phone 7 开发 31 日谈——第3日:返回键
- 如何解决结果由block返回情况下的同步问题
- serialVersionUID的作用以及如何用idea自动生成实体类的serialVersionUID
- 如何让UIView中的Button点击之后跳转到另一个ViewController上去,ViewController上也有一个按钮 可以返回
- C/C++函数如何返回struct或class对象
- 后台返回一个string类型的json格式数据,前台js如何读取?
- 如何解读返回函数指针的函数声明
- MyBaits:如何接收Mysql存储过程多个返回集
- jsr 303 如何控制错误信息的顺序_及groups标记属性的作用和用法
- 工作流中如何返回上一步
- Cocos2d-x CCTouchBegin 的bool返回值的作用
- 如何取得中的存储过程的返回值
- 打开 Freetextbox 的 InsertImageFromGallery 及如何接收 ftb.imagegallery.aspx 返回的图片信息
- 企业网站如何发挥作用
- php之mongodb插入数据后如何返回当前插入记录ID
- 记录:java执行mysql语句查询字段类型:timestamp返回页面显示会多出个 .0,自己如何处理的
- MapGuide Tips----如何在MapGuide Fusion Viewer里设置搜索选中地物时的Scale?
- Android 如何让dialog不消失,即使是用户按了返回键dialog也不消